Looking to start your career in Human Resources? Postbank is offering a unique HR Internship Programme for 2026, giving unemployed graduates an opportunity to gain practical work experience, develop key HR skills, and build a strong CV in a corporate banking environment.
This 12-month structured programme is based at Postbank’s Pretoria Head Office and is designed to give you hands-on exposure to HR processes, policies, and professional development practices. With only five positions available, competition is tight – applicants are encouraged to submit their applications before the closing date of 25 February 2026.
The Postbank HR Internship is ideal for graduates who want to bridge the gap between academic learning and the workplace, particularly in human resources, organizational development, or industrial psychology. Who Can Apply?
The programme is designed for recent graduates who are eager to learn and build their career in HR. To qualify, you must meet the following requirements:
- South African citizen with a valid ID
- Unemployed at the time of application
- Degree or Diploma in one of the following fields:
- Human Resource Management
- Industrial Psychology
- Human Resource Development
- NQF Level 6 or higher
- Basic computer literacy, including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ills
- Willingness to learn and adapt in a corporate environment

What You’ll Learn and Do
The Postbank HR Internship provides a hands-on, practical learning experience. Interns will take part in several HR functions, including:
- Recruitment and Onboarding: Assist with posting job adverts, screening candidates, conducting interviews, and helping new employees settle in.
- HR Administration: Manage employee records, track leave and attendance, and support HR reporting.
- Talent Management: Gain exposure to learning and development initiatives, performance appraisals, and career planning tools.
- Employee Engagement: Participate in surveys, feedback initiatives, and team-building activities.
- HR Projects: Contribute to ongoing HR projects, such as policy development, process improvement, and compliance with labour laws.
